Job Title: Senior Snowflake Data Engineer
Location: Columbia, MD (Hybrid)
Job Type: Contract-to-Hire

Our client is seeking an experienced Senior Snowflake Data Engineer to design, build, and optimize cloud-based data solutions supporting enterprise healthcare operations. The ideal candidate has strong hands-on experience with Snowflake, SQL, JSON, and Python (Snowpark), along with a solid foundation in data modeling, governance, and automation within AWS environments.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and optimize data pipelines, transformations, and models in Snowflake.
  • Implement Streams, Tasks, and Materialized Views for real-time and batch processing.
  • Build and automate CI/CD pipelines using Jenkins or similar tools.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ver scalable and reliable data solutions.
  • Support real-time data ingestion from Oracle to AWS using DMS and integrate with Kafka/dbt.
  • Ensure data quality, governance, and compliance (HIPAA, PHI/PII).

Required Skills:

  • 5+ years in Data Engineering, 3+ years in Snowflake (Streams, Tasks, performance tuning).
  • Expertise in SQL, Python (Snowpark), JSON, and dimensional modeling.
  • Experience with AWS services (S3, DMS, Glue) and CI/CD automation.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.

Preferred:

  • Experience with dbt, Kafka, or data quality frameworks (Great Expectations).
  • Snowflake certification and healthcare data background are highly desirable.

This is a hybrid C2H role offering the opportunity to work on real-time data integration and mission-critical healthcare systems in a modern cloud environment.
